 It is the xsl:apply-templates, xsl:apply-imports, and xsl:for-each XSLT
 instructions that cause nodes to be processed. They are processed in a certain
 order: document order, normally, or reverse document order if a reverse axis
 like ancestor:: was used, or whatever order was specified by xsl:sort.

Actually document order is always used in the absence of xsl;sort, even
for reverse axes.
